Decisions & Actions

He told me of our fate

She impressed on me to cogitate:

By decisions and by actions

We fall or we will elevate


To hide our lies may tempt our gaze

But truth will ever penetrate

By decisions and by actions

We fall or we will elevate


We may try, but we will fail

Should we attempt to forward blame

By decisions and by actions

We fall or we will elevate


Privilege and wealth may mitigate

But time and tide adjudicate

By decisions and by actions

We fall or we will elevate


Damned or praised by what we say

But what we do will seal our fate

By decisions and by actions

We fall or we will elevate



Martin Wardley 27th Jan 2022
